Modi's performance-the bad points
by Anil Gonsalves on Oct 18, 2007 01:49 PM

Now for the bad points:

1.Sufalam Sujalam has become Sufalam Dhanayam. 3,000 crores have been spent to no avail and the promises of water flowing in North Gujarat have been exposed. This is the biggest faliure of the Modi govt whih they cannot deny. How much money has been spent to no avail and how much money has been made by whom? These are 3,000 crore questions? His biggest faliure, undoubtely. The only Sufalam Sujalam has been the sound of money, not water.

2.) MoUs not materialising: Look at Adani signing an MoU for a port education institute, Nirma for another institute in marine engineering. Where are they today? JF Patel's mega investment in Gujarat, ambitious plans to build India's tallest skyscrapers, proposed
casino and convention centre in Surat, complete ignoral of Baroda's devolopment (all the money has been poured into improving A'mbad and Surat), A'mbad CBD, bio-deisel buses for GSRTC not working out, Gujarat maritime unable to meet its targets in time, scores of other MoUs not working out,even a die-hard Modi fan would agree that the government signs a hundred MoUs and maybe 10-20 % actually materialize.

3.) Only A'mbad is getting 24 hours power. Rajkot, Surat, Jamnagar, do face powercuts. IN Surat there were four hour powercuts. Hence, everyone is not benefitting from the so-called 24 hours power supply.
